Step into the most extraordinary classic-car showroom in Germany — a converted 1897 tram depot now home to over 100 immaculate vintage and collector automobiles. A private expert guide reveals the engineering artistry and history behind each masterpiece.
What to expect
The soaring brick rotunda of the former tram depot creates a spectacular setting for over 100 collector vehicles spanning a century of automotive excellence — from gleaming 1930s Mercedes-Benz SSKs to post-war Ferrari Berlinettas and iconic Porsche racing cars. A private guide takes you behind the velvet rope into the working restoration workshops, where white-coated craftsmen are mid-restoration on cars worth millions. The specialist dealers operating within the Remise can arrange viewings of vehicles not on public display. A glass of Sekt in the in-house café among these rolling sculptures is an unforgettable finale.
Good to know
The Classic Remise is a 10-minute taxi ride from the city centre. Open Tuesday–Sunday; free general entry means you can browse at leisure, but pre-arrange a private guide for the full behind-the-scenes experience. Ideal for a morning visit before the Königsallee in the afternoon.
